Description

【考案の詳細な説明】 本案は扇風機の羽根およびガードをコンパクトに梱包す
る装置に関する。
[Detailed Description of the Invention] The present invention relates to a device for compactly packing fan blades and guards.

一般に輸出用の扇風機等における梱包装置は一台の扇風
機の構成部品を一個の外装箱体内に収めるようなことは
なく、同種類の構成部品を一個の箱体内に適数収納する
ようにしている。
In general, packaging equipment for export fans, etc. does not store the components of a single fan in a single outer box, but instead stores an appropriate number of components of the same type in a single box. .

そして構成部品の形状を考慮し、適数個のガードにて適
数個の羽根を包むようにして一個の箱体内に収納する梱
包装置が普通である。
In consideration of the shape of the component parts, it is common to use a packaging device that wraps an appropriate number of blades with an appropriate number of guards and stores them in a single box.

だが前記ガードが傾斜した状態で箱体内に収納されると
、ガードに無理な力が作用し、変形するといったことが
あった。
However, if the guard is stored in the box in an inclined state, an unreasonable force is applied to the guard, causing it to deform.

本案は上記点に鑑み、ガードが傾斜しないようにすると
共に梱包も容易に行なえるようにした装置を提供するも
ので、以下本案の一実施例を図面に基づき説明する。
In view of the above points, the present invention provides a device that prevents the guard from tilting and also allows easy packaging.An embodiment of the present invention will be described below with reference to the drawings.

本実施例において、羽根1と前ガード2と後ガード3を
それぞれ扇風機4台分を一個の外装箱体4に収納するも
のである。
In this embodiment, the blades 1, the front guard 2, and the rear guard 3, each corresponding to four electric fans, are housed in one exterior box 4.

前記羽根1は扇風機の電動機に装着するボス部5と、該
ボス部5の周面に形設した複数枚の羽根片6とよりなる
The blade 1 consists of a boss part 5 that is attached to an electric motor of a fan, and a plurality of blade pieces 6 formed around the boss part 5.

該羽根片6は送風効率を向上せしめるため扇状に形設さ
れると共にひねりが加えられている。
The blade pieces 6 are fan-shaped and twisted in order to improve air blowing efficiency.

4枚の羽根1は梱包時次のように重ねられる。The four blades 1 are stacked as follows during packaging.

2枚の羽根1の一方を上向きにし、他方を下向きにした
状態で重ね合わせたものを2組重ね合わせる(以下この
組み合わせを羽根体Aと称す)。
Two sets of two blades 1 are stacked one on top of the other with one facing upward and the other facing downward (hereinafter, this combination will be referred to as blade body A).

該羽根体Aの各羽根片6の一部は相互に端縁で衝合する
ことなく相互が離間して面対向するように位置せしめる
と共に、各羽根1の相互間には保護紙(図示しない)を
介在せしめる。
A portion of each blade piece 6 of the blade body A is spaced apart from each other and placed so as to face each other without abutting each other at their edges, and a protective paper (not shown) is placed between each blade 1. ) to intervene.

前記前ガード2および後ガード3は同一ガードを4枚重
ね合わせる(以下重ね合わせたものをガード体Bおよび
Cと称す)。
The front guard 2 and the rear guard 3 are made by stacking four identical guards (hereinafter, the stacked pieces will be referred to as guard bodies B and C).

該ガード体BおよびCの各ガード間には保護紙(図示し
ない)を介在せしめる。
A protective paper (not shown) is interposed between each guard of the guard bodies B and C.

7は前記ガード体BおよびC間の内側にて被さるように
挾持される段ボール紙製の略円筒状緩衝体で、該緩衝体
7は同一形状の4枚の折曲段ボール紙8を連結せしめて
形設する。
Reference numeral 7 denotes a substantially cylindrical cushioning body made of corrugated paper which is sandwiched between the guard bodies B and C so as to cover them. form

前記緩衝体7の内径は前記羽根1の外径と略同−に形設
され、前記羽根体1は緩衝体7内に収納される。
The inner diameter of the buffer body 7 is formed to be approximately the same as the outer diameter of the blade 1, and the blade body 1 is housed within the buffer body 7.

前記段ボール紙8は折曲部9にて横方向に三等分され、
該折曲部9の上部と下部にV字状切溝10を形設して、
複数のフラップ11を形設している。
The corrugated paperboard 8 is laterally divided into three equal parts at the bending part 9,
V-shaped grooves 10 are formed at the upper and lower parts of the bent portion 9,
A plurality of flaps 11 are formed.

該フラップ11の新曲部12は、フラップの折曲を容易
ならしめるために段ボール紙を押し潰している。
The new bend portion 12 of the flap 11 is made of crushed corrugated paper to facilitate folding of the flap.

前記段ボール紙8の両側には前記折曲部12.12間よ
り少し短いフラップ13を形設している。
On both sides of the corrugated paperboard 8, flaps 13 are formed which are slightly shorter than between the folds 12 and 12.

前記段ボール紙8は互いのフラップ13.13を接着、
ホッチキスといった慣用の接合手段を用いることで接合
され、前記緩衝体7を構成する。
The corrugated paper 8 is glued to each other's flaps 13, 13,
They are joined by using a conventional joining means such as a stapler, thereby forming the buffer body 7.

この時前記フラップ13は緩衝体の外側縦方向に伸びる
如く接合される。
At this time, the flaps 13 are joined so as to extend in the longitudinal direction on the outside of the cushioning body.

次に作用を説明する。Next, the action will be explained.

外装箱体4に前記一方のガード体Cを収納する。The one guard body C is housed in the exterior box body 4.

この時該ガード体Cはその外側を下にその内側を上にし
て収納される。
At this time, the guard body C is stored with its outside facing down and its inside facing up.

その後緩衝体7を前記ガード体C上に載置し、緩衝体7
を押圧する。
After that, the buffer body 7 is placed on the guard body C, and the buffer body 7 is placed on the guard body C.
Press.

該押圧は緩衝体7の上部にもフラップ11を形設してい
るため上部に強い力を加えて行なえない。
Since the flap 11 is also formed on the upper part of the buffer body 7, this pressing cannot be performed by applying strong force to the upper part.

しかし本案は緩衝体7の側面にフラップ13が突設して
おり、該フラップ13を持って押圧することができる。
However, in the present invention, a flap 13 is provided protruding from the side surface of the buffer body 7, and the flap 13 can be held and pressed.

そうすることで前記フラップ11は前記ガード体C内側
の傾斜部分に案内されて内側に折曲せしめられる。
By doing so, the flap 11 is guided by the inclined portion inside the guard body C and is bent inward.

よってあらかじめフラップ11を内側に折曲しておくと
いった手間をかけすとも単にガード体Cの内側に押し付
けるだけでフラップ11を折曲することができるもので
ある。
Therefore, even if it takes time and effort to bend the flap 11 inward in advance, the flap 11 can be bent simply by pressing it against the inside of the guard body C.

また前記緩衝体7に強い力を加えても前記フラップ13
がガード体Cの外周部に当接するので、前記フラップ1
1が曲がり過ぎることがない。
Moreover, even if a strong force is applied to the buffer body 7, the flap 13
comes into contact with the outer periphery of the guard body C, so that the flap 1
1 is not too bent.

次に前記羽根体Aを緩衝体7内に収納せしめた後前記他
方のガード体Bを前記緩衝体7に載置せしめる。
Next, after the blade body A is housed in the buffer body 7, the other guard body B is placed on the buffer body 7.

この時前記ガード体Bの内側は緩衝体7に当接しており
、ガード体Bを押圧することで、前記フラップ11は前
述と同様にガード体B内面に案内されて内側に折曲する
At this time, the inner side of the guard body B is in contact with the buffer body 7, and by pressing the guard body B, the flap 11 is guided by the inner surface of the guard body B and bent inward in the same manner as described above.

この時前記ガード体Bの外周部が前記フラップ13に当
接するので、前記フラップ11が曲がり過ぎることがな
い。
At this time, since the outer circumference of the guard body B comes into contact with the flap 13, the flap 11 does not bend too much.

最後に前記外装箱体4の上面開口を箱体の内外フラップ
にて閉塞して梱包は完了する。
Finally, the upper opening of the outer box 4 is closed with the inner and outer flaps of the box to complete the packaging.

梱包せしめた状態において緩衝体7内に収納した羽根1
が傾むいたとしても羽根片6の角縁部はガード体B、C
に直接当接することはなく、前記フラップ11に当接す
るもので、ガードおよび羽根が傷つくことがない。
The blade 1 stored in the buffer body 7 in the packed state
Even if the blade pieces 6 are tilted, the corner edges of the blade pieces 6 are guard bodies B and C.
The guard and the blades will not be damaged because they do not come into direct contact with the flap 11, but the flap 11.

前記ガード体B、Cの外周部は前記フラップ13に当接
しているので、輸送時の振動等により前記緩衝体7に対
して前記ガード体B、Cが傾くことがなく安定に保持さ
れると共に、外箱に作用する外力がガード体B、Cに作
用しても効率よく吸収され無理な力が加わることがない
Since the outer peripheral portions of the guard bodies B and C are in contact with the flap 13, the guard bodies B and C are not tilted relative to the buffer body 7 due to vibrations during transportation, and are stably held. Even if an external force acting on the outer box acts on the guard bodies B and C, it is efficiently absorbed and no unreasonable force is applied.

また前記フラップ13は外装箱体4の内面に当接してい
るので外装箱体4に加わる力を緩衝体7で吸収できるも
のである。
Further, since the flap 13 is in contact with the inner surface of the outer box 4, the force applied to the outer box 4 can be absorbed by the buffer body 7.

以上の如く本案は、段ボール紙等よりなる外装箱体と、
該箱体内に収納する前後ガード間に挾持させると共にそ
の内部に羽根を収納する段ボール紙製略円筒状緩衝体と
を備え、該緩衝体の外側には前記ガードの外周部が当接
するフラップを形設したものなので、前記ガードが箱体
内で傾斜することがなく無理な力が作用することがない
等、実用的効果は大なるものである。
As described above, the present proposal consists of an outer box body made of corrugated paper, etc.
A substantially cylindrical cushioning body made of corrugated paper is provided, which is sandwiched between the front and rear guards housed in the box body, and the blades are housed inside the cushioning body, and a flap is formed on the outside of the cushioning body, with which the outer periphery of the guard comes into contact. Since the guard is installed in the box, it has great practical effects, such as preventing the guard from tilting inside the box and causing no unreasonable force to be applied to it.
